Zoning
MXD
Mixed-Use Development District
The MXD district is intended to allow flexible site planning and building arrangements for commercial, office and residential uses under a unified plan which fosters natural resource conservation and reduces traffic congestion. This may permit buildings and uses to be clustered or arranged in an unconventional manner to maximize open space, create a pedestrian scale and other public benefits. Plans should include a combination of related uses residential, office, retail, entertainment, civic space, and/or government uses. Vertical integration is encouraged to maximize the use of land. In all cases, the site should be designed to be highly walkable, whereby the pedestrian experience is safe and enjoyable. Residential buildings must be designed and constructed so as to meet the definition of 4-sided architecture, as defined in Section 724.02. All commercial building facades visible from a public street must also be designed and constructed so as to meet the definition of 4-sided architecture, as defined in Section 724.02. In this district smaller lots than might otherwise be permitted under traditional zoning districts may be allowed; however, the purpose is not merely to allow smaller lots or reduce development requirements but to achieve other goals including the protection of sensitive environmental, historic, or aesthetic resources as well as the provision of site amenities such as parks, open space, walking trails, etc. The MXD district is not intended to encourage greater density of development, but rather to facilitate compatible commercial and non-commercial uses and provide quality developments which enhance the surrounding area. This district may also be utilized to foster the adaptive reuse of existing buildings.
